We recently brought home an assorted bouquet from the local grocery store. I know...not normally the best flowers for photo's. The thing of it is, if I waited for the best flowers to use for a photo...I would not take many flower pics.

I took several and used completely poor technique. For instance,  I was in extremely low light, and any light I did have was blocked by my shadow. I did these hand held with higher ISO than I like to use.

Although soft I find myself rather drawn to this shot. This is framed as I saw it in camera...however, I did tweak contrast, clarity and vibrance in Lightroom.

EXIF>>Canon 40d , Tamron 90mm Macro : 1/15, f/2.8, ISO 800
